Why Do I Write Poetry?



God made me suddenly, a bard;
It was by serendipity;
I took my pen and worked quite hard;
Words gushed from heart as poetry!

I wrote in times of stress and strain;
God sowed His words into my heart;
They helped unload heart's anguish, pain;
With years, my poetry turned smart!

Oh what a pleasant job, I do!
Most magic words are all within;
God gives this gift to just a few;
I won over my stress and sin!

I wrote with zeal much on my part;
With time, God's grace had blessed my art.
